SB 1027 Texas Senate · 89th Legislature (2025)

Relating to the Internet broadcast or recording of certain open meetings.

SB 1027 requires Texas state agencies with annual budgets exceeding $10 million and 100+ employees to live-stream public meetings via video and audio on their websites in real-time. Agencies must archive these recordings for two years, making them available within seven days of the meeting. Smaller agencies must provide audio or video recordings within seven days instead of live streaming. The law applies to meetings held on or after September 1, 2027, with exemptions for emergencies or technical failures.
